Output 370d69efd33d6ed0a506f8f99bff5d38cd3a03a9f711c8d2d35a1fd1a1b0aeea:52

value
80930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06bc39a475373604f0d24fd380038f3a955b7cc4 OP_EQUAL
address
32JdTor85GcXnaxf1ZujhJMFz4ec3n2voG
transaction
370d69efd33d6ed0a506f8f99bff5d38cd3a03a9f711c8d2d35a1fd1a1b0aeea
confirmations
194438
spent
true